Regioselective synthesis of 3-acylated 2,5-dihydrothiophene S,S-dioxides via ultrasound-promoted allylzincation of 3-bromo-2,3-dihydrothiophene S,S-dioxide

3-Acylated2,5-dihydrothiopheneS,S-dioxides were synthesized from 3-hydroxyalkylated 2,3-dihydrothiophene S,S-dioxides, prepared highly regioselectivelyviaultrasound-promotedallylzincation of 3-bromo-2,3-dihydro-thiophene S,S-dioxide.

The Effect of Lithium Ion on the Regioselectivity of Substitution Reactions of Zinc Sulfolenylate

AbstractThe addition of lithium cation to zinc sulfolenylates significantly changes the regioselectivity of its reaction toward carbonyl electrophiles. The more lithium salt is added, the more the reactions prefer to take place at the α‐position of the sulfolenylate.
